Inspection of 22 October 2024 — Inspection Report

Full report (PDF, Tusla)

Immediate action notice. An Immediate Action notice was issued to the service on the 22 October 2024 in relation to Regulation 23- Safeguarding, Health, Safety and Welfare of Child. Please see body of report for details • On the 22 October 2024 the registered provider responded to the immediate action notice with the measures implemented within the service to mitigate the risk identified.

Regulation 9 — Management and recruitment

  • 1. Three written references for the two support workers were not validated. 2. One support worker did not have a second validated written reference. (d) Police vetting was not available for two staff working in the service who had lived outside the jurisdiction for longer than six months as an adult. (4) Two staff members employed by the registered provider did not have evidence to demonstrate that they held a major award in Early Childhood Care and Education at Level 5 or above on the National Framework of Qualifications
Provider's corrective action:
  • In response the service has stated that the references have been received and validated. The service will ensure that all references, including those from outside agencies, are contacted, validated and a written record is maintained. (d) • In response the registered provider has stated that following the inspection it was confirmed that one staff member spent less than 6 months outside the jurisdiction and therefore does not require police vetting. • The second staff member has started the process to obtain vetting from the necessary country. (4) In response the registered provider has stated that one staff member’s college award is now attached. The second staff member is no longer working in the service

Regulation 23 — Safeguarding health, safety and welfare of child

  • General Safety: 1. The surface temperature of the radiator in Room 2 was recorded as 57.50C at 10:04am, this is at variance with the maximum recommended temperature of 500C. This increased the potential risk of burning a child. An immediate action notice was issued to the registered provider during the inspection and a response was received from the service on the 22 October 2024. Infection Control: 2. Children’s perishable food items such as cheese, yogurts and meats were not refrigerated on arrival to Room 2. This increased the potential risk of food borne infections. 3. Handwashing practice before meals were not consistently followed by all children. This increased the potential risk of cross infection. Action submitted by the Registered Provider
Provider's corrective action:
  • General Safety: 1. In response to the Immediate action notice the registered provider responded on the 22 October 2024 with the actions taken to reduce the risk identified on inspection. The service stated that the control dial valve on the radiator has now been turned down and the service had engaged with a heating and plumbing engineer to review the radiator to ensure that the level is below the maximum temperature of 500C. Infection Control: 2. In response the service has stated that they are purchasing a new small fridge for the second class so they can easily put their lunches into the fridge and so they don’t have to travel through a classroom and into the kitchen. 3. The two teachers running classroom 2 will ensure that the children always wash their hands, on arrival, after the garden and before the snack time

Regulation not named in the report text

  • (1) The service is currently registered to operate an early years’ service from 9am-2pm and 1-4pm Monday to Friday. However, on review of the roll book it was observed that a child has been present in the service from 8:45am on 11 occasions since the 30 September 2024. This is at variance with the service registered status
Provider's corrective action:
  • (1) In response the service has stated that the child that attended at 8.45am from 14th October 2024 is no longer coming at that time. This situation will not arise again as children will only attend Mo’s Montessori within the operating hours of 9am-2pm and 1-4pm. Summary Comment The registered provider has addressed the non-compliance through the corrective and preventive action taken.
